Responsibilities:

We are looking for a mix of a product analyst/systems analyst and the following skillsets:

  • Mappings -XML to JSON mapping process - understanding flow of data and conditionality to create mappings - both business value and technical implementation
  • Technical Acumen -able to create user stories that are driven from customer value/business needs while at same time understanding the technical piece of implementation
  • Communication -being able to articulate both business and technical aspects
  • Develop and maintain comprehensive documentation of business processes, systems, and data flows.
  • Candidate will be primarily responsible to understand and document the current data mappings in existing system and create the data mappings in the new system.
  • Utilize SQL to extract, manipulate, and analyze data to support business decision-making and process improvements.
  • Work closely with IT teams to design, test, and implement system enhancements and new applications.
  • Facilitate effective communication between technical and non-technical stakeholders to ensure alignment and understanding.
  • Conduct regular reviews and evaluations of system performance, identifying areas for improvement.
  • Provide training and support to end-users to ensure efficient use of business systems.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Information Systems, Computer Science, or a related field.
  • Must have experience with RDBMS including but not limited to Oracle, DB2
  • Strong proficiency in SQL for data analysis and reporting.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to convey complex information clearly and concisely.
  • Analytical mindset with strong problem-solving skills.
  • Must have strong experience and knowledge of the Secondary Mortgage Domain.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ment.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.

Preferred Skills:

  • Familiarity with mortgage industry processes and terminology.
  • Experience with data visualization tools and techniques. Understanding of project management methodologies and tools.
